Subject: PCI/ASPM: Return 0 or -ETIMEDOUT from  pcie_retrain_link()
Git-commit: f5297a01ee805d7fa569d288ed65fc0f9ac9b03d
Patch-mainline: 6.5-rc1
References: git-fixes

"pcie_retrain_link" is not a question with a true/false answer, so "bool"
isn't quite the right return type.  Return 0 for success or -ETIMEDOUT if
the retrain failed.  No functional change intended.
